Large-angle alpha-particle scattering from thin foils contradicted diffuse-charge atomic models and led Rutherford to a compact, positively charged nucleus.

The unexpected backscattering required a compact concentration of positive charge and led to the nuclear atom.
How to interpret this relation type
The source experiment, observation, anomaly, or problem materially motivated the development, revision, or acceptance of the target concept. Historical influence is not logical derivation; the edge detail states the documented role and avoids retrospective origin myths.
